<h2 id="AppPermissions">Specify App Permissions</h2>
|
||||
<p>
|
||||
Apps that use Location Services must request location permissions. Android has two location
|
||||
permissions: {@link android.Manifest.permission#ACCESS_COARSE_LOCATION ACCESS_COARSE_LOCATION}
|
||||
and {@link android.Manifest.permission#ACCESS_FINE_LOCATION ACCESS_FINE_LOCATION}. The
|
||||
permission you choose controls the accuracy of the current location. If you request only coarse
|
||||
location permission, Location Services obfuscates the returned location to an accuracy
|
||||
that's roughly equivalent to a city block.
|
||||
</p>
|
||||
<p>
|
||||
Requesting {@link android.Manifest.permission#ACCESS_FINE_LOCATION ACCESS_FINE_LOCATION} implies
|
||||
a request for {@link android.Manifest.permission#ACCESS_COARSE_LOCATION ACCESS_COARSE_LOCATION}.
|
||||
</p>
|
||||
<p>
|
||||
For example, to add {@link android.Manifest.permission#ACCESS_COARSE_LOCATION
|
||||
ACCESS_COARSE_LOCATION}, insert the following as a child element of the
|
||||
<code><a href="{@docRoot}guide/topics/manifest/manifest-element.html"><manifest></a></code>
|
||||
element:
|
||||
</p>
|
||||
<pre>
|
||||
<uses-permission android:name="android.permission.ACCESS_COARSE_LOCATION"/>
|
||||
</pre>

<h2 id="permissions">Specify App Permissions</h2>
|
||||
|
||||
<p>Apps that use location services must request location permissions. Android
|
||||
offers two location permissions:
|
||||
{@link android.Manifest.permission#ACCESS_COARSE_LOCATION ACCESS_COARSE_LOCATION}
|
||||
and
|
||||
{@link android.Manifest.permission#ACCESS_FINE_LOCATION ACCESS_FINE_LOCATION}.
|
||||
The permission you choose determines the accuracy of the location returned by
|
||||
the API. If you specify
|
||||
{@link android.Manifest.permission#ACCESS_COARSE_LOCATION ACCESS_COARSE_LOCATION},
|
||||
the API returns a location with an accuracy approximately equivalent to a city
|
||||
block.</p>
|
||||
|
||||
<p>This lesson requires only coarse location. Request this permission with the
|
||||
{@code uses-permission} element in your app manifest, as shown in the
|
||||
following example:
|
||||
|
||||
<pre>
|
||||
<manifest xmlns:android="http://schemas.android.com/apk/res/android"
|
||||
package="com.google.android.gms.location.sample.basiclocationsample" >
|
||||
|
||||
<uses-permission android:name="android.permission.ACCESS_COARSE_LOCATION"/>
|
||||
</manifest>
|
||||
</pre>

<p>
|
||||
You should create the location client in {@link android.support.v4.app.FragmentActivity#onCreate
|
||||
onCreate()}, then connect it in
|
||||
{@link android.support.v4.app.FragmentActivity#onStart onStart()}, so that Location Services
|
||||
maintains the current location while your activity is fully visible. Disconnect the client in
|
||||
{@link android.support.v4.app.FragmentActivity#onStop onStop()}, so that when your app is not
|
||||
visible, Location Services is not maintaining the current location. Following this pattern of
|
||||
connection and disconnection helps save battery power. For example:
|
||||
</p>
|
||||
<p class="note">
|
||||
<strong>Note:</strong> The current location is only maintained while a location client is
|
||||
connected to Location Service. Assuming that no other apps are connected to Location Services,
|
||||
if you disconnect the client and then sometime later call
|
||||
<code><a href="{@docRoot}reference/com/google/android/gms/location/LocationClient.html#getLastLocation()">getLastLocation()</a></code>,
|
||||
the result may be out of date.
|
||||
</p>
